Jacob Frey: “The interference itself is a breach of trust.”

Featuring: Jacob Frey, Democratic–Farmer–Labor | Mayor of Minneapolis | Minnesota

Although the investigators have concluded that this interference does not change their ultimate conclusion contained in the original report. In other words, the allegations of relationships with city employees, The interference itself is a breach of trust. Because of that, I informed the chief that I would be disciplining him up to and including discharge, and he resigned. I have accepted his resignation. (01:47–01:50)
